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- Whether the proposed development complies with the conditions, limitations and restrictions applicable to Class PA of Part 3, Schedule 2 of the Town and Country Planning (General Permitted Development) (England) Order 2015 (as amended) (GPDO), and is therefore permitted development
What decided it
The prior approval date falls after the 1 October 2020 deadline specified in GPDO paragraph PA.1(c), with no transitional arrangements permitting the development.
